description Product Description

Sodium tetraborate solution is widely used across various industries as a precursor for producing boron and other boron compounds. It serves as a buffering agent in cleaning products and laundry detergents to maintain pH stability, and acts as a water softener by binding to metal ions, improving cleaning efficiency, particularly in dishwashing liquids and detergents for removing grease and stains.

In the pulp and paper industry, it helps control mold and condition water during production. Employed in the formulation of adhesives and cellulose derivatives for viscosity control. Commonly found in household and industrial disinfectants due to mild antimicrobial properties, and in oral health products such as certain mouthwashes.

Used in the manufacture of glass, ceramics, and enamel glazes as a fluxing agent to lower melting temperatures and enhance heat and shock resistance. Applied in metallurgy as a flux for soldering and welding to prevent oxidation. Utilized in electroplating baths to enhance conductivity and deposit uniformity.

In agriculture, it provides a source of boron essential for plant growth, especially in high-boron-demand crops like oranges and beets. Serves as a preservative in some wood treatments and as a fire retardant in cellulose insulation. Also used in educational and laboratory settings for buffer solutions, chemical demonstrations, and pH control in analytical work.
